When contributing to this repository, please first discuss the change you wish to make with an issue.
- Ideas are a valuable source of contributions others can make
- Problems show where this project is lacking
- With a question you show where contributors can improve the project
- Before opening a new issue, make sure there is not an existing one about your same problem/request.
- Please use the provided issue templates.
- If you want to add a new feature create a new issue if there is no one for it.
- You should be clear which problem you're trying to solve with your contribution.
- Fork this repository.
- Make your changes addressing one thing at a time with meaningful commit messages
- Update the README as needed
- Try to keep Pull requests short and concise focused in one aspect of the project